Western Saddle
Definition
1) **Western Saddle (noun):** A type of saddle used for the activity of Western riding, typically used in sports such as rodeo, reining, cutting, and Western pleasure. It is characterized by a deep seat, high cantle, horn for roping, and a large, flat skirt that distributes the rider's weight over a larger area of the horse's back.
2) **Western Saddle (noun):** A piece of equipment placed on a horse's back for the rider to sit on while riding in a Western-style equestrian discipline. Western saddles are known for their sturdy construction and often include decorative elements such as tooling, silver conchos, and leather lacing.
3) **Western Saddle (noun):** A specialized type of saddle designed to provide stability and comfort for both horse and rider during Western horseback riding activities. Unlike English saddles, Western saddles have a prominent horn at the front, which can be used for attaching ropes in activities like roping cattle.
